
数据降频算法有哪些
常见问答
什么是数据降频,为什么需要使用数据降频算法?
我刚接触数据处理,看到很多提到数据降频的算法,能否解释一下什么是数据降频,使用这些算法的目的是是什么?
数据降频的定义与作用
数据降频是一种减少数据采样率的技术,目的是降低数据量以便于存储和处理,同时尽量保持数据的主要特征和信息。应用数据降频算法可以帮助节省存储空间、减少计算资源消耗,以及提高数据处理效率,尤其在信号处理、传感器数据管理等领域非常重要。
常见的数据降频算法有哪些,它们各自的特点是什么?
我想了解常用的数据降频算法类型,还有它们在实际应用中有什么优势和适用场景?
主流数据降频算法简介
一些常见的数据降频算法包括平均值滤波器、中值滤波器、低通滤波器、重采样技术和主成分分析(PCA)。平均值滤波器适用于去除随机噪声,中值滤波器对去除脉冲噪声效果较好,低通滤波器帮助滤除高频干扰信号,重采样则通过调整采样频率来降低数据量,PCA能在多维数据中提取主要成分以减少维度。不同算法根据数据特性和应用需求选择使用。
如何选择合适的数据降频算法来处理特定类型的数据?
面对不同类型的数据,例如音频信号、传感器数据或图像数据,怎样选择合适的数据降频方法?
选择合适数据降频算法的指导原则
选择数据降频算法时,需要考虑数据的性质、目标应用和对精度的要求。音频信号通常采用低通滤波结合重采样,保持声音的关键频率成分;传感器数据可采用滤波器去噪后进行适当采样;图像数据则倾向于利用PCA等降维技术减小数据规模。评估算法对数据完整性的影响以及计算资源限制,有助于决定最适合的降频策略。